Ticket #RV-2291: DiffHarbor choking on connections again

Hey folks — users comparing files over 500 MB in DiffHarbor keep getting "connection reset" halfway through the render. Looks like the chunk-index service drops its pool when the diff takes longer than two minutes. Restarting the pod helps for a bit, then it's back. If you need to poke at the chunk-index database directly, connect with the string below.

warehouse DSN: mssql://rusdor_svc:0FSWCn9@db-951a.paliqforge.local:5432/ulawyn

Finance Review — Hiring Freeze, Northgate Division

Quick summary for sales leads: the freeze in Northgate trims payroll by about 6% this half, which keeps our margin targets intact without touching commission pools. Open territories will be covered by existing reps through year-end. Don't promise clients new account managers just yet. Here's the bit to keep to yourselves.

board note of fahag-tajop: The eastern region missed its Julix quota by 44.0 percent last quarter. Ralionax Holdings plans to lower the Druath list price by 61.8 percent in March. The board signed off on a budget of $295.0 million for Project Gilath. The renewal with Ruswynix Systems closes at $274.5 million a year, 17.0 percent above the last contract.

## Environment Variables — Hermetic Migration

As part of migrating the Lanthorn build to the Quarryline hermetic toolchain, all host-inherited variables are now stripped at sandbox entry. Anything the build genuinely needs must be declared explicitly in env.lock and reviewed by the Build Infra rotation. Do not reintroduce implicit PATH or HOME lookups; they will fail silently under Quarryline. The signing step still requires one credential, sourced from the vault at release time. Add the following line to env.lock:

secret setting of tawif-tajop: COURIER_KEY13=819c65d82d2bd